Skip to content

Commit

Permalink
Autogenerated update (2020-09-29)
Browse files Browse the repository at this point in the history
Update:
- androidmanagement_v1
- androidpublisher_v3
- apigee_v1
- assuredworkloads_v1beta1
- genomics_v2alpha1
- sheets_v4
- texttospeech_v1beta1
- toolresults_v1beta3
- translate_v3
- youtube_v3
  • Loading branch information
googleapis-publisher committed Sep 29, 2020
1 parent 9ab74e5 commit a4dd7b6
Show file tree
Hide file tree
Showing 22 changed files with 812 additions and 121 deletions.
47 changes: 47 additions & 0 deletions api_names_out.yaml
Expand Up @@ -9583,6 +9583,7 @@
"/androidpublisher:v3/ProductPurchase/purchaseToken": purchase_token
"/androidpublisher:v3/ProductPurchase/purchaseType": purchase_type
"/androidpublisher:v3/ProductPurchase/quantity": quantity
"/androidpublisher:v3/ProductPurchase/regionCode": region_code
"/androidpublisher:v3/ProductPurchasesAcknowledgeRequest": product_purchases_acknowledge_request
"/androidpublisher:v3/ProductPurchasesAcknowledgeRequest/developerPayload": developer_payload
"/androidpublisher:v3/Prorate": prorate
Expand Down Expand Up @@ -14288,6 +14289,40 @@
"/artifactregistry:v1beta1/fields": fields
"/artifactregistry:v1beta1/key": key
"/artifactregistry:v1beta1/quotaUser": quota_user
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1CreateWorkloadOperationMetadata": google_cloud_assuredworkloads_v1_create_workload_operation_metadata
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1CreateWorkloadOperationMetadata/complianceRegime": compliance_regime
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1CreateWorkloadOperationMetadata/createTime": create_time
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1CreateWorkloadOperationMetadata/displayName": display_name
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1CreateWorkloadOperationMetadata/parent": parent
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load": google_cloud_assuredworkloads_v1_workload
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/billingAccount": billing_account
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/cjisSettings": cjis_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/complianceRegime": compliance_regime
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/createTime": create_time
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/displayName": display_name
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/etag": etag
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/fedrampHighSettings": fedramp_high_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/fedrampModerateSettings": fedramp_moderate_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/il4Settings": il4_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/labels": labels
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/labels/label": label
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/name": name
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/resources": resources
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1Workload/resources/resource": resource
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adCJISSettings": google_cloud_assuredworkloads_v1_workload_cjis_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adCJISSettings/kmsSettings": kms_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adFedrampHighSettings": google_cloud_assuredworkloads_v1_workload_fedramp_high_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adFedrampHighSettings/kmsSettings": kms_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adFedrampModerateSettings": google_cloud_assuredworkloads_v1_workload_fedramp_moderate_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adFedrampModerateSettings/kmsSettings": kms_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adIL4Settings": google_cloud_assuredworkloads_v1_workload_il4_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adIL4Settings/kmsSettings": kms_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adKMSSettings": google_cloud_assuredworkloads_v1_workload_kms_settings
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adKMSSettings/nextRotationTime": next_rotation_time
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adKMSSettings/rotationPeriod": rotation_period
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adResourceInfo": google_cloud_assuredworkloads_v1_workload_resource_info
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adResourceInfo/resourceId": resource_id
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1WorkloadResourceInfo/resourceType": resource_type
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1beta1CreateWorkloadOperationMetadata": google_cloud_assuredworkloads_v1beta1_create_workload_operation_metadata
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1beta1CreateWorkloadOperationMetadata/complianceRegime": compliance_regime
"/assuredworkloads:v1beta1/GoogleCloudAssuredworkloadsV1beta1CreateWorkloadOperationMetadata/createTime": create_time
Expand Down Expand Up @@ -102637,6 +102672,8 @@
"/genomics:v2alpha1/Event/details": details
"/genomics:v2alpha1/Event/details/detail": detail
"/genomics:v2alpha1/Event/timestamp": timestamp
"/genomics:v2alpha1/ExistingDisk": existing_disk
"/genomics:v2alpha1/ExistingDisk/disk": disk
"/genomics:v2alpha1/FailedEvent": failed_event
"/genomics:v2alpha1/FailedEvent/cause": cause
"/genomics:v2alpha1/FailedEvent/code": code
Expand Down Expand Up @@ -102699,6 +102736,10 @@
"/genomics:v2alpha1/OperationMetadata/runtimeMetadata": runtime_metadata
"/genomics:v2alpha1/OperationMetadata/runtimeMetadata/runtime_metadatum": runtime_metadatum
"/genomics:v2alpha1/OperationMetadata/startTime": start_time
"/genomics:v2alpha1/PersistentDisk": persistent_disk
"/genomics:v2alpha1/PersistentDisk/sizeGb": size_gb
"/genomics:v2alpha1/PersistentDisk/sourceImage": source_image
"/genomics:v2alpha1/PersistentDisk/type": type
"/genomics:v2alpha1/Pipeline": pipeline
"/genomics:v2alpha1/Pipeline/actions": actions
"/genomics:v2alpha1/Pipeline/actions/action": action
Expand Down Expand Up @@ -102763,6 +102804,12 @@
"/genomics:v2alpha1/VirtualMachine/nvidiaDriverVersion": nvidia_driver_version
"/genomics:v2alpha1/VirtualMachine/preemptible": preemptible
"/genomics:v2alpha1/VirtualMachine/serviceAccount": service_account
"/genomics:v2alpha1/VirtualMachine/volumes": volumes
"/genomics:v2alpha1/VirtualMachine/volumes/volume": volume
"/genomics:v2alpha1/Volume": volume
"/genomics:v2alpha1/Volume/existingDisk": existing_disk
"/genomics:v2alpha1/Volume/persistentDisk": persistent_disk
"/genomics:v2alpha1/Volume/volume": volume
"/genomics:v2alpha1/WorkerAssignedEvent": worker_assigned_event
"/genomics:v2alpha1/WorkerAssignedEvent/instance": instance
"/genomics:v2alpha1/WorkerAssignedEvent/machineType": machine_type
Expand Down
2 changes: 1 addition & 1 deletion generated/google/apis/androidmanagement_v1.rb
Expand Up @@ -26,7 +26,7 @@ module Apis
# @see https://developers.google.com/android/management
module AndroidmanagementV1
VERSION = 'V1'
REVISION = '20200824'
REVISION = '20200925'

# Manage Android devices and apps for your customers
AUTH_ANDROIDMANAGEMENT = 'https://www.googleapis.com/auth/androidmanagement'
Expand Down
2 changes: 1 addition & 1 deletion generated/google/apis/androidpublisher_v3.rb
Expand Up @@ -25,7 +25,7 @@ module Apis
# @see https://developers.google.com/android-publisher
module AndroidpublisherV3
VERSION = 'V3'
REVISION = '20200916'
REVISION = '20200927'

# View and manage your Google Play Developer account
AUTH_ANDROIDPUBLISHER = 'https://www.googleapis.com/auth/androidpublisher'
Expand Down
7 changes: 7 additions & 0 deletions generated/google/apis/androidpublisher_v3/classes.rb
Expand Up @@ -1225,6 +1225,12 @@ class ProductPurchase
# @return [Fixnum]
attr_accessor :quantity

# ISO 3166-1 alpha-2 billing region code of the user at the time the product was
# granted.
# Corresponds to the JSON property `regionCode`
# @return [String]
attr_accessor :region_code

def initialize(**args)
update!(**args)
end
Expand All @@ -1244,6 +1250,7 @@ def update!(**args)
@purchase_token = args[:purchase_token] if args.key?(:purchase_token)
@purchase_type = args[:purchase_type] if args.key?(:purchase_type)
@quantity = args[:quantity] if args.key?(:quantity)
@region_code = args[:region_code] if args.key?(:region_code)
end
end

Expand Down
Expand Up @@ -716,6 +716,7 @@ class Representation < Google::Apis::Core::JsonRepresentation
property :purchase_token, as: 'purchaseToken'
property :purchase_type, as: 'purchaseType'
property :quantity, as: 'quantity'
property :region_code, as: 'regionCode'
end
end

Expand Down
2 changes: 1 addition & 1 deletion generated/google/apis/apigee_v1.rb
Expand Up @@ -29,7 +29,7 @@ module Apis
# @see https://cloud.google.com/apigee-api-management/
module ApigeeV1
VERSION = 'V1'
REVISION = '20200921'
REVISION = '20200924'

# View and manage your data across Google Cloud Platform services
AUTH_CLOUD_PLATFORM = 'https://www.googleapis.com/auth/cloud-platform'
Expand Down
10 changes: 5 additions & 5 deletions generated/google/apis/apigee_v1/classes.rb
Expand Up @@ -3749,8 +3749,8 @@ class GoogleCloudApigeeV1Organization
include Google::Apis::Core::Hashable

# Required. Primary GCP region for analytics data storage. For valid values, see
# [Create an organization](https://docs.apigee.com/hybrid/latest/precog-
# provision).
# [Create an Apigee organization](https://cloud.google.com/apigee/docs/api-
# platform/get-started/create-org).
# Corresponds to the JSON property `analyticsRegion`
# @return [String]
attr_accessor :analytics_region
Expand All @@ -3760,7 +3760,7 @@ class GoogleCloudApigeeV1Organization
# @return [Array<String>]
attr_accessor :attributes

# Compute Engine network used for ServiceNetworking to be peered with Apigee
# Compute Engine network used for Service Networking to be peered with Apigee
# runtime instances. See [Getting started with the Service Networking API](https:
# //cloud.google.com/service-infrastructure/docs/service-networking/getting-
# started). Valid only when [RuntimeType] is set to CLOUD. The value can be
Expand Down Expand Up @@ -5264,8 +5264,8 @@ class GoogleCloudApigeeV1SyncAuthorization
# com` You might specify multiple service accounts, for example, if you have
# multiple environments and wish to assign a unique service account to each one.
# The service accounts must have **Apigee Synchronizer Manager** role. See also [
# Create service accounts](https://docs.apigee.com/hybrid/latest/sa-about#create-
# the-service-accounts).
# Create service accounts](https://cloud.google.com/apigee/docs/hybrid/latest/sa-
# about#create-the-service-accounts).
# Corresponds to the JSON property `identities`
# @return [Array<String>]
attr_accessor :identities
Expand Down
40 changes: 21 additions & 19 deletions generated/google/apis/apigee_v1/service.rb
Expand Up @@ -83,8 +83,8 @@ def list_hybrid_issuers(name, fields: nil, quota_user: nil, options: nil, &block
execute_or_queue_command(command, &block)
end

# Creates an Apigee organization. See [Create an organization](https://docs.
# apigee.com/hybrid/latest/precog-provision).
# Creates an Apigee organization. See [Create an Apigee organization](https://
# cloud.google.com/apigee/docs/api-platform/get-started/create-org).
# @param [Google::Apis::ApigeeV1::GoogleCloudApigeeV1Organization] google_cloud_apigee_v1_organization_object
# @param [String] parent
# Required. Name of the GCP project in which to associate the Apigee
Expand Down Expand Up @@ -119,8 +119,9 @@ def create_organization(google_cloud_apigee_v1_organization_object = nil, parent
execute_or_queue_command(command, &block)
end

# Gets the profile for an Apigee organization. See [Organizations](https://docs.
# apigee.com/hybrid/latest/terminology#organizations).
# Gets the profile for an Apigee organization. See [Understanding organizations](
# https://cloud.google.com/apigee/docs/api-platform/fundamentals/organization-
# structure).
# @param [String] name
# Required. Apigee organization name in the following format: `organizations/`
# org``
Expand Down Expand Up @@ -188,9 +189,9 @@ def get_organization_deployed_ingress_config(name, fields: nil, quota_user: nil,
# calling [setSyncAuthorization](setSyncAuthorization) to ensure that you are
# updating the correct version. If you don't pass the ETag in the call to `
# setSyncAuthorization`, then the existing authorization is overwritten
# indiscriminately. For more information, see [Enable Synchronizer access](https:
# //docs.apigee.com/hybrid/latest/synchronizer-access#enable-synchronizer-access)
# . **Note**: Available to Apigee hybrid only.
# indiscriminately. For more information, see [Configure the Synchronizer](https:
# //cloud.google.com/apigee/docs/hybrid/latest/synchronizer-access). **Note**:
# Available to Apigee hybrid only.
# @param [String] name
# Required. Name of the Apigee organization. Use the following structure in your
# request: `organizations/`org``
Expand Down Expand Up @@ -225,8 +226,8 @@ def get_organization_sync_authorization(name, google_cloud_apigee_v1_get_sync_au
end

# Lists the Apigee organizations and associated GCP projects that you have
# permission to access. See [Organizations](https://docs.apigee.com/hybrid/
# latest/terminology#organizations).
# permission to access. See [Understanding organizations](https://cloud.google.
# com/apigee/docs/api-platform/fundamentals/organization-structure).
# @param [String] parent
# Required. Use the following structure in your request: `organizations`
# @param [String] fields
Expand Down Expand Up @@ -262,9 +263,9 @@ def list_organizations(parent, fields: nil, quota_user: nil, options: nil, &bloc
# to ensure that you are updating the correct version. To get an ETag, call [
# getSyncAuthorization](getSyncAuthorization). If you don't pass the ETag in the
# call to `setSyncAuthorization`, then the existing authorization is overwritten
# indiscriminately. For more information, see [Enable Synchronizer access](https:
# //docs.apigee.com/hybrid/latest/synchronizer-access#enable-synchronizer-access)
# . **Note**: Available to Apigee hybrid only.
# indiscriminately. For more information, see [Configure the Synchronizer](https:
# //cloud.google.com/apigee/docs/hybrid/latest/synchronizer-access). **Note**:
# Available to Apigee hybrid only.
# @param [String] name
# Required. Name of the Apigee organization. Use the following structure in your
# request: `organizations/`org``
Expand Down Expand Up @@ -2912,8 +2913,8 @@ def get_organization_envgroup_attachment(name, fields: nil, quota_user: nil, opt

# Lists all attachments of an environment group.
# @param [String] parent
# Required. Name of the organization in the following format: `organizations/`
# org``.
# Required. Name of the environment group in the following format: `
# organizations/`org`/envgroups/`envgroup``.
# @param [Fixnum] page_size
# Maximum number of environment group attachments to return. The page size
# defaults to 25.
Expand Down Expand Up @@ -3113,9 +3114,9 @@ def get_organization_environment_deployed_config(name, fields: nil, quota_user:
end

# Gets the IAM policy on an environment. For more information, see [Manage users,
# roles, and permissions using the API](https://docs.apigee.com/hybrid/latest/
# manage-users-roles). You must have the `apigee.environments.getIamPolicy`
# permission to call this API.
# roles, and permissions using the API](https://cloud.google.com/apigee/docs/
# api-platform/system-administration/manage-users-roles). You must have the `
# apigee.environments.getIamPolicy` permission to call this API.
# @param [String] resource
# REQUIRED: The resource for which the policy is being requested. See the
# operation documentation for the appropriate value for this field.
Expand Down Expand Up @@ -3157,8 +3158,9 @@ def get_organization_environment_iam_policy(resource, options_requested_policy_v

# Sets the IAM policy on an environment, if the policy already exists it will be
# replaced. For more information, see [Manage users, roles, and permissions
# using the API](https://docs.apigee.com/hybrid/latest/manage-users-roles). You
# must have the `apigee.environments.setIamPolicy` permission to call this API.
# using the API](https://cloud.google.com/apigee/docs/api-platform/system-
# administration/manage-users-roles). You must have the `apigee.environments.
# setIamPolicy` permission to call this API.
# @param [String] resource
# REQUIRED: The resource for which the policy is being specified. See the
# operation documentation for the appropriate value for this field.
Expand Down
2 changes: 1 addition & 1 deletion generated/google/apis/assuredworkloads_v1beta1.rb
Expand Up @@ -25,7 +25,7 @@ module Apis
# @see https://cloud.google.com
module AssuredworkloadsV1beta1
VERSION = 'V1beta1'
REVISION = '20200914'
REVISION = '20200924'

# View and manage your data across Google Cloud Platform services
AUTH_CLOUD_PLATFORM = 'https://www.googleapis.com/auth/cloud-platform'
Expand Down

0 comments on commit a4dd7b6

Please sign in to comment.